May 19, 2006, Newsletter Issue #64: Orange Glazed Salmon

Tip of the Week

4 (4 ounce) salmon fillets
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p pepper
3 Tbsp soy sauce
3 Tbsp orange juice
1/2 tsp dark sesame oil
cooking spray

Sprinkle fish with salt and pepper. Coat a large nonstick skillet with cooking spray; place over high heat until hot. Add fish, and cook, uncovered, 3 minutes on each side. Cover and cook 3 additional minutes or until fish flakes easily when tested with a
fork.

Remove from skillet; set aside, and keep warm. Add soy
sauce and orange juice to skillet; cook over high heat 1 minute, stirring to deglaze skillet. Add oil, and stir well. Pour sauce over fish, and serve immediately.
